Die oben erwähnten Glasarten zeichnen sich gewöhnlich durch bestimmte Eigenschaften, beispielsweise durch thermische Eigenschaften, durch Eigenschaften gegen die Sonnenstrahlung und durch Sicherheitseigenschaften usw., zum Nachteil anderer Eigenschaften aus.The known insulating glasses usually consist of some types of glasses, such as clear, ornamental, security, metallization, etc., which are interconnected. The connection of two thermal disks is performed, for example, on the glass periphery by means of an assembly comprising a gasket and a spacer frame which forms a shallow cavity filled with gas or air with said two thermal disks. Between the discs, a hollow waveguide is also attached. Two insulating glasses can also be mounted in a wooden frame and connected to the spacer frame. There are also known triple discs, which consist of three thermal discs, which are interconnected. The thermal transmittance of the double pane glass is minimal U = 1,1W / m 2 , the thermal transmittance of the triple glazing is U = 0,8W / m 2 to 1,1W / m 2 . The known safety glasses are usually formed by a surface connection of two or more clear glass panes with one or more layers of polyvinyl butyral film, which is characterized by high strength, adhesion and elasticity. If these glasses are broken, the broken pieces will stick to the foil, reducing or eliminating the risk of personal injury. Safety glasses having a heat setting (semi-curing) of the clear glass are also known, whereby the strength against mechanical and thermal stresses or against shocks is increased. It is possible to sandwich the glass in the thermal wafers and in the PVB interlayers. These two joint materials can create a very clear product that is virtually impervious. The glass may also have a special structure to withstand fire and heat radiation emanating from the fire from a safe distance. The glass types mentioned above are usually characterized by certain properties, for example, thermal properties, solar radiation properties, safety properties, etc., to the detriment of other properties.

In the case of a glass formed by two thermo disks between which the polycarbonate disk and / or the polymethacrylate disk is inserted, the thermal transmittance is U = 0.5 to 0.8 W / m 2 . The main advantage, however, is that the glasses are bullet resistant to a projectile with the caliber of 9mm and higher.
